prodigious

英 [prəˈdɪdʒəs]

美 [prəˈdɪdʒəs]

adj.  巨大的; 伟大的

TOEFLIELTSGRE

Collins.1 / BNC.14631 / COCA.14195

牛津词典

    adj.

    • 巨大的;伟大的
      very large or powerful and causing surprise or admiration
      1. a prodigious achievement/memory/talent
        惊人的成就 / 记忆力 / 才华
      2. Laser discs can store prodigious amounts of information.
        激光磁盘能够贮存大量信息。

    柯林斯词典

    • ADJ-GRADED 巨大的;庞大的;大得惊人的
      Something that isprodigiousis very large or impressive.
      1. This business generates cash in prodigious amounts...
        这种业务收益丰厚。
      2. He impressed all who met him with his prodigious memory.
        他惊人的记忆力让所有见过他的人都印象深刻。
